FINANCE REVIEW SUMMARY — SUPPLIER CONTRACT RENEWAL

Quick rundown for branch managers: the Dunmore Packaging contract is up for renewal next quarter, and the numbers mostly look fine. Unit costs rose about 4%, offset by better freight terms and fewer damaged shipments. We're pushing for a volume rebate tier before signing; expect an answer within three weeks. Keep ordering as usual in the meantime — no stockpiling, please. There's one bigger-picture reason we're negotiating hard, covered in the confidential note below.

board note of kageg-bahof: The renewal with Holwynax Holdings closes at $2 million a year, 5 percent below the last contract. Project Ulaath slips by two quarters because of the supplier delay.

## Authentication

Quick note for review: the Crumbelle order-cutoff service rejects bakery orders placed after the nightly cutoff, and that check runs server-side only. All cutoff API calls need a bearer token scoped to `orders:write`. Nothing is trusted from the client clock. The sandbox credential for testing sits right below.

session JWT of yawep-yawep = eyJhbGciOiJIUzI1NiIsInR5cCI6IkpXVCJ9.eyJzdWIiOiI3pWF3_In0.aXYsHiog

Finance Review Summary — Orlet Partners Term Sheet

The Orlet Partners term sheet proposes a three-year supply commitment with volume rebates and a co-marketing fund. Margins meet our threshold; the exclusivity clause on the Larkspur line needs renegotiation. Legal review completes Thursday. Heads of department should note the strategic context appended below.

internal memo for bawef-kajef: Novokix Logistics is in early talks to buy Briaelax Freight for about $167.0 million. The Zorius launch date is April 3, and nothing goes to the press before then. Legal wants the Frairax Holdings term sheet redrafted before August 10.

### Runbook: Report export timezone mismatches (Glimmerfield)

If a customer reports that exported totals differ from the dashboard, check whether their report schedule predates the March cutover — older schedules still render in server-local time rather than the account timezone. Re-saving the schedule fixes it. Before escalating, confirm the export worker is running with the expected timezone settings shown below.

config for kadup-kajog:
[raldor]
host = raldor.tolvaqworks.internal
user = raldor_svc
database = raldor_prod